The Staff Accountant will play a crucial role in supporting the financial operations of CyberOne. This position includes a combination of responsibilities related to financial record-keeping, analysis, and reporting. The Staff Accountant will work closely with the accounting team to ensure timely recording of financial transactions, compliance, and the generation of financial reports. The ideal candidate possesses a strong understanding of accounting principles, excellent analytical skills, and the ability to work effectively both independently and as part of a team.

The position will report to the Controller and is based in our Plano, TX office.

Essential Functions

  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date financial records through timely recording of transactions.
  • Perform monthly reconciliations of bank accounts, credit card statements, and other balance sheet accounts.
  • Play a vital role in the month-end and year-end close process.
  • Review and analyze revenue and expense transactions to ensure compliance with accounting standards and company policies.
  • Assist in the reconciliation and remittance of Sales & Use Tax.
  • Review and approve reimbursable expenses and credit card transactions.
  • Support the daily processing of customer invoices and vendor bills.
  • Analyze financial data and provide insights to management for decision-making purposes.
  • Ensure compliance with relevant accounting principles, standards and regulations.
  • Proactively identify opportunities for process improvement within the accounting department.
